Universal Confirmations
To ensure that all SWIFT customer payments can be fully tracked, FIN users will be required to provide a "confirmation" to the Tracker. This will enable transparency, richer information, and superior user experience across the end-to-end payment processing chain and to the benefit of all eligible FIN users.

Universal Confirmations
All eligible FIN users (of categories SUPE and PSPA) have access to Universal Confirmations by default. A usage rule applies to MT 103, MT 103 STP, MT 103 REMIT, requiring all FIN users to confirm the status of the transaction to the Tracker within maximum two business days following its value date. Five channels are available to confirm payments to the Tracker: Basic Tracker GUI, MT 199, XML ISO (as of 2021), CSV Batch Confirmations and API.
Subscription to the API service must be done for each non-gpi BIC that will confirm payments using the Universal Confirmations API. Please place the test order first before the corresponding live one.
